internetnews.com: Path to Firefox 2.0 is Cleared
Nov 9, 2006, 19 :45 UTC (0 Talkback[s]) (6283 reads)

(Other stories by Sean Michael Kerner)

"Mozilla has updated its now legacy 1.5.x Firefox browser to version 1.5.0.8, with fixes for three critical security flaws.

"The flaws do not affect the recently released Firefox 2.0 version. The latest 1.5.0.8 release will also include an update that will make it easier for existing users to get major upgrades from Mozilla..."
